If you're doing it in a pit (Luau style or Cuban), and you've dressed the pig properly, I'd give solidly 24 hours. This depends entirely on how well you have built your pit, and what the temperature is where the pig is placed. You want the pig smoking around 220F-240F, roughly. If you're asking this question here, I strongly suggest you get someone who has a lot of experience in this process to show you exactly how. If you aren't Very experienced, you can easily poison your guests (if it's too cold) or ruin 200lbs of meat.

I would say 7-8 hours depending on the temperature. Ideally you want to cook pork around 200 degrees for a long slow time. A whole pig will be done when the shoulders and the butts have reached a temperature of at least 170-180 degrees. 180 degrees is the ideal temp for pork.

Roasting time on a 25lb pig takes as long as it has to to reach a internal temperature of 190 degrees. And the time also depends on the cooking temperature and cooking technique. sample: a barrel BBQ at a temperature of 275 degrees with a 25lb. pig might take approx. 10 to 12 hours.

Cooking time for a 100 pound pig is typically 15 to 17 hours. It should cook at 225 - 250 degrees.

To roast a 120 pound pig, you can bet on it taking approximately 1 hour per 10 pounds. This means that it will take about 12 hours. This can vary depending on the temperature.
